Output 668a9bc853a6241d23d4d1369db6746c0cbb043facdd93769f218b18318fc530:2

value
82212503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b82bf7e030a5a0a201d07f31a6ec6c68614708 OP_EQUAL
address
MLunp9X91rHRSzi8QnWyiuUbdmvW7YNJ8e
transaction
668a9bc853a6241d23d4d1369db6746c0cbb043facdd93769f218b18318fc530
spent
true